SWAC Announces Football Players of the Week – Oct. 19

SWAC-LogoOFFENSIVE – QB K.J. Black, Prairie View A&M; 6-4, 225; JR; Louisville, KY

Black completed 17 of 23 passes for 235 yards and three touchdowns in the Panthers’ 38-0 win over Mississippi Valley State.

Black threw scoring passes of 28 and eight yards in the first quarter and eight yards in the second quarter to three different receivers as the Panthers won their third consecutive game.

DEFENSIVE – LB Cliff Exama, Grambling State; 6-0, 226; SO; North Miami Beach, FL

Recorded 15 tackles (9 solo), 1.5 sack, 2.5 TFL (-14 yards) in the Tigers’ 23-12 win at Alabama State.

Exama made a sack in the second quarter and combined with teammate Christian Anthony for a fourth-quarter sack.

NEWCOMER – DB Tim Berry, Southern; 5-10, 185; SO; St. Francisville, LA

Berry made four tackles along with two interceptions in helping Southern to a 55-23 win over Ft. Valley State.

Berry made both interceptions in the second quarter, the first pick in the end zone to thwart a Ft. Valley State drive, with the second coming on the final play of the first half.

SPECIALIST – WR Austin Nwokobia, Prairie View A&M; 6-5, 215; SR; Sugar Land, TX

Nwokobia blocked two punts in the first half that led to touchdowns in the Panthers’ win over Mississippi Valley State.

Nwokobia blocked a pair of punts in the first quarter that led to 14 Prairie View A&M points.

OTHER NOTABLE PERFORMANCES

RB Arnold Walker (Alcorn State) – Ran 14 times for 92 yards and two touchdowns vs. Alabama A&M

RB Frank Warren (Grambling State) – Had 12 carries for 91 yards with two touchdowns vs. Alabama State

RB Gary Holliman (Southern) – Rushed six times for a career high 115 yards and two touchdowns and caught one pass for six yards vs. Ft. Valley State

QB Arvell Nelson (Texas Southern) – Completed 18 of 31 passes for 242 yards and two touchdowns and added 13 rushing yards vs. Jackson State.

DB Tomasi Fuller (Alcorn State) – Recorded 1.5 tackles (1 solo,0. 5 assists) 1.0 tackles for loss for 6 yards, and two interceptions for 36 yards vs. Alabama A&M

LB Adrian Hardy (Alabama State) – Led the team with nine tackles including a team-leading 2.5 TFL (-10 yards) with one sack and one forced fumble vs. Grambling State

DB Malcolm Palmer (Jackson State) – Recorded a game high 14 tackles (7 solo, 4 for loss) with 1.0 sack and one pass breakup vs. Texas Southern

LB Max Sencherey (Prairie View A&M) – Made 11 tackles with one forced fumble vs. Mississippi Valley State

LB Andre Coleman (Southern) – Made a game and team-high 13 tackles (one for loss) and two interceptions, including returning one 34 yards for a touchdown vs. Ft. Valley State

DL John Cole (Texas Southern) – Made three solo tackles (two for loss) with one sack vs. Jackson State

Alfred Moreland (Jackson State) -Had four kickoff returns for 69 yards and a long return of 30 yards.

WR Nick Andrews (Alabama State) – Posted 188 all-purpose yards including 82 on kickoff returns and 22 on punt returns in addition to catching six passes for 84 yards vs. Grambling State
